You will provide accounting and advisory services to a portfolio of Clients, with a majority of these being in the Agri field although some exposure to commercial clients. This will include the preparation of complex:
- Financial statements, drafting and finals.
- Tax returns for Individuals, Trusts, Partnerships, Companies, and Incorporated Societies.
- GST, FBT, & RWT returns, plus preparation of dividends and/or DWT returns.
- Cashflow reports, budgets, provisional tax estimates and other advisory jobs as necessary.

You will have a relevant tertiary qualification, with a minimum of 4 years’ experience in a Public Practice environment. You will have experience working with Agricultural clients, along with being proficient in the use of MYOB and Xero accounting systems. You will regularly use the IRD, ACC, and Companies Office websites, plus research tools to stay abreast of system and accounting changes.
Your experience will demonstrate an understanding of relevant legislation, external reporting standards 1-5, tax entity profiles, and the use of CCH electronic workpapers.
